Herman Wedel Jarlsberg


Johan Caspar Herman Wedel Jarlsberg was a Norwegian statesman and count. He played an active role in the constitutional assembly at Eidsvoll in 1814 and was the first native Norwegian to hold the post of governor during the union with Sweden.

Wedel Jarlsberg was born in Montpellier, France, son of Diplomat Frederik Anton WedelJarlsberg and Catharina Storm . He studied law in Copenhagen and graduated in 1801. He accepted a commission as the kings official for the district of Buskerud in 1806.
